What Lavender Ice Really Costs Landed

Build lavender ice price tiers around order sizes your customers actually place. Tiers that only make sense on a spreadsheet get ignored, and you end up discounting ad hoc instead.

When you model lavender ice pricing, build in a realistic shrink figure. Even a well run line loses a small percentage to damage, expiry and sampling. Pretending that number is zero is how a healthy looking margin turns negative.

Indicative reference points for planning purposes: entry tier from USD 1.58 per unit at 1000 units, mid tier at USD 1.04, and volume tier at USD 0.91 for full container quantities. These figures move with specification, packaging and freight, so treat them as a shape rather than a quote.

How Lavender Ice Batches Are Checked

Inspection is only useful if the result is recorded somewhere you can find it later. A lavender ice batch log with weights, codes and measurements turns a future complaint into a five minute lookup.

The cheapest quality control step is a retained sample. Keeping three sealed units from every lavender ice batch costs almost nothing and turns any dispute into a simple comparison instead of an argument over photographs.
